Shafi Inamdar has been one of the selected artists of Bollywood cinema who is remembered as the best actor. He worked in the film industry for nearly two decades. In addition to films, he was also active in the TV industry. Today is Shafi Inamdar's birthday.

Shafi has been one of the selected artists in the cinema world who never played the main role but wins the hearts of the audience by playing the side roll. He was born on 23rd October 1945. He started his film career with the winning film in the year 1982. He came into the limelight by playing Inspector Haider Ali in the film 'Ardh Satya ' in the year 1983. Shafi played the role of a police inspector in several movies. In some films, he also played negative characters.

Shafi Inamdar is still in millions of hearts. He always played a supporting role in a good manner. At that moment, his acting and dialogue were so beautiful that even in small horns, he had mastered the attention of the people. They worked in movies like Jurm, Izzatdaar, Phool Bane Angare, Krantiveer, Yashwant, Akele Hum Akele Tum. He worked in the film ' Yashwant ' with actor Nana Patkar and the film proved to be the last film of his career.
